I love that you can pre-submit the license application online and then get a quick confirmation when you are able to come in to show your IDs and collect your license. The office is a little difficult to find, however - - go downstairs and keep walking past the hearing rooms. Once there, sign in on the computer past the chairs. The staff is pretty friendly and helpful and the process pretty simple. Also, did you know you can self-officiate? Pretty amazing perk in DC.
